- 小程序打开失败
[图片] 后来打开了 但是想了解一下这种情况出现的概率和具体场景? 你们有没有遇到过?
2017-01-11 - touch事件渲染层报错
Unable to preventDefault inside passive event listener due to target being treated as passive. See https://www.chromestatus.com/features/5093566007214080 跟chrome相关的错误 虽然不影响任何效果,但看着有错误闹心,不知可否解决?
2017-01-04 - 安卓的input获取焦点时会出现placeholder文字重影
21号的更新不是说已经修复了吗?为什么我在最新的安卓微信端还是会出现这个问题?重影大概0.几秒
2017-01-02 - 希望增加修改swiper指示点样式的属性
现在只能用默认的黑/灰色圆点,而且位置也固定,对于实现效果造成一定困难,希望能增加api,使显示效果灵活一些。
2017-01-02 - 生成的二维码如何显示?
如图,得到的结果是这样的 [图片] 不知道是需要转码还是?
2016-12-31 - 打开失败?
如图,环境是iPhone SE 请问这是什么情况?打开的是首页,不是每次都出现。 [图片]
2016-12-25 - 请问真机调试如何清缓存?
RT
2016-12-22 - 更新产生的一个bug(附个人解决方案)
[代码]环境:微信IOS 6.5.2[代码] [代码] [代码] [代码]问题描述:定义一个[代码][代码]template模板内(作用域A)有个for循环(作用域B),初始化时,B可以拿到A的值,但是动态setData之后(A、B的value同时更新),B无法拿到A的更新后的值。(在之前的微信版本没有出现此问题) [代码] [代码] [代码] [代码]个人解决方法:模板引入时,添加多个data,在setData时,设置新的data把A的值覆盖,再传给B就能拿到了引入的data。 [代码] [代码] [代码] [代码]仍然存在的问题:数据变化前后的视图能被肉眼看到,也就是会闪。 延伸:如果setData放在wx.request回调里,由于request不支持同步,会导致上述方法失效,这时需要在onReady里setData,目的是修改data。虽然request回调受网络影响,也就是可能在onReady之后执行,而且在模拟器上的确有时会出现失效问题,但是真机测试没有问题,只是闪的情况依然存在。[代码] [代码] [代码] [代码]吐槽:为什么官方文档的更新日志不写详细点,就这么惜字如金?模拟器与真机的一致性能不能有保证?request不支持同步你们说是「考虑[代码][代码]到网络问题,会给用户带来不好的操作体验[代码][代码][代码]」[代码],但我们开发者才是你的直接用户,你们当前该关心的难道不应该是我们的体验吗?我们在社区的提问有几个能得到官方及时解答的?[代码]
2016-12-22 - 更新后的模板传值问题
template模板中写了循环时,循环内部可以调用外部的值 但是如果动态改变循环数组的值,内部调用的外部值将被清空 [代码]<[代码][代码]template[代码] [代码]is[代码][代码]=[代码][代码]"testName"[代码] [代码]data[代码][代码]=[代码][代码]"{{...testData}}"[代码] [代码]/>[代码][代码]<[代码][代码]template[代码] [代码]name[代码][代码]=[代码][代码]"testName"[代码][代码]>[代码][代码] [代码][代码]<[代码][代码]view[代码] [代码]bindtap[代码][代码]=[代码][代码]"testChange"[代码][代码]>[代码][代码] [代码][代码]<[代码][代码]block[代码] [代码]wx:for[代码][代码]=[代码][代码]"{{key2}}"[代码] [代码]wx:key[代码][代码]=[代码][代码]"*this"[代码][代码]>[代码][代码] [代码][代码]{{key1}}[代码][代码] [代码][代码]{{item}}[代码][代码] [代码][代码][代码]block[代码][代码]>[代码][代码][代码][代码] [代码][代码][代码]view[代码][代码]>[代码][代码][代码][代码][代码][代码][代码]template[代码][代码]>[代码][代码][代码][代码] [代码]var[代码] [代码]pageData = {[代码][代码] [代码][代码]data: {[代码][代码] [代码][代码]testData: {[代码][代码]'key1'[代码][代码]: [代码][代码]'value1'[代码][代码], [代码][代码]'key2'[代码][代码]: [[代码][代码]'value2_1'[代码][代码],[代码][代码]'value2_2'[代码][代码]]}[代码][代码] [代码][代码]},[代码][代码] [代码][代码]testChange: [代码][代码]function[代码][代码](){[代码][代码] [代码][代码]this[代码][代码].setData({[代码][代码] [代码][代码]testData: {[代码][代码]'key1'[代码][代码]: [代码][代码]'value1'[代码][代码], [代码][代码]'key2'[代码][代码]: [[代码][代码]'value2_3'[代码][代码],[代码][代码]'value2_4'[代码][代码]]}[代码][代码] [代码][代码]})[代码][代码] [代码][代码]}[代码][代码]}[代码] 页面先显示 value1 value2_1 value1 value2_2 点击后触发testChange事件,内容变为 value2_3 value2_4 所以我要怎么写才能在循环内部拿到value1?
2016-12-21 - 6.5.2更新后模板传值问题
template模板中写了循环时,循环内部可以调用外部的值 但是如果动态改变循环数组的值,内部调用的外部值将被清空 [代码]<[代码][代码]template[代码] [代码]is[代码][代码]=[代码][代码]"testName"[代码] [代码]data[代码][代码]=[代码][代码]"{{...testData}}"[代码] [代码]/>[代码] [代码]<[代码][代码]template[代码] [代码]name[代码][代码]=[代码][代码]"testName"[代码][代码]>[代码][代码] [代码][代码]<[代码][代码]view[代码] [代码]bindtap[代码][代码]=[代码][代码]"testChange"[代码][代码]>[代码][代码] [代码][代码]{{key1}}[代码][代码] [代码][代码]<[代码][代码]block[代码] [代码]wx:for[代码][代码]=[代码][代码]"{{key2}}"[代码] [代码]wx:key[代码][代码]=[代码][代码]"*this"[代码][代码]>[代码][代码] [代码][代码]{{key1}}[代码][代码] [代码][代码]{{item}}[代码][代码] [代码][代码]</[代码][代码]block[代码][代码]>[代码][代码] [代码][代码]</[代码][代码]view[代码][代码]>[代码][代码]</[代码][代码]template[代码][代码]>[代码] [代码]var[代码] [代码]pageData = {[代码][代码] [代码][代码]data: {[代码][代码] [代码][代码]testData: {[代码][代码]'key1'[代码][代码]: [代码][代码]'value1'[代码][代码], [代码][代码]'key2'[代码][代码]: [[代码][代码]'value2_1'[代码][代码],[代码][代码]'value2_2'[代码][代码]]}[代码][代码] [代码][代码]},[代码][代码] [代码][代码]testChange: [代码][代码]function[代码][代码](){[代码][代码] [代码][代码]this[代码][代码].setData({[代码][代码] [代码][代码]testData: {[代码][代码]'key1'[代码][代码]: [代码][代码]'value1'[代码][代码], [代码][代码]'key2'[代码][代码]: [[代码][代码]'value2_3'[代码][代码],[代码][代码]'value2_4'[代码][代码]]}[代码][代码] [代码][代码]})[代码][代码] [代码][代码]}[代码][代码]}[代码] 页面先显示 value1 value1 value2_1 value2_2 点击后触发testChange事件,内容变为 value1 value2_3 value2_4 问题来了 循环内部写的{{key1}}跑哪了?
2016-12-21